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ying specialized coatings or sealants to the exterior or interior surfaces of a building’s foundation. The primary goal is to create a protective barrier that prevents moisture from penetrating the concrete, which can lead to a range of structural issues. These services often include cleaning the foundation surface, repairing minor cracks or damages, and then applying sealants designed to resist water infiltration. The process helps reinforce the foundation’s integrity by reducing the risk of water-related problems that could compromise the stability of the entire structure.
One of the main problems that foundation sealing addresses is water intrusion. Excess moisture can cause concrete to deteriorate over time, leading to cracks, spalling, or even shifting of the foundation. When water seeps into the foundation, it can also promote the growth of mold and mildew inside the property, which may affect indoor air quality. Sealing services help mitigate these issues by creating a barrier that keeps moisture out, thereby extending the lifespan of the foundation and reducing the likelihood of costly repairs in the future.

Material and Surface Preparation - Costs for preparing concrete surfaces typically range from $300 to $800, depending on the size and condition of the area. Proper cleaning and sealing are essential for effective waterproofing and protection.
Sealing Application - The application of concrete sealing services generally costs between $1.50 and $3.50 per square foot. For a typical residential foundation, this may total around $600 to $1,400.
Additional Repairs or Repairs - If cracks or damage are present, repair costs can add $200 to $1,000 or more, depending on severity. Proper sealing often requires addressing underlying issues beforehand.
Project Size and Complexity - Larger or more complex projects tend to increase costs, with total expenses potentially reaching $2,000 or higher for extensive foundations.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ete foundation sealing? Concrete foundation sealing involves applying a protective coating or membrane to the surface of a foundation to prevent water infiltration and reduce damage caused by moisture.
Why is sealing a foundation important? Sealing helps protect the foundation from water damage, cracking, and mold growth, which can lead to structural issues over time.
How often should a foundation be sealed? The frequency of sealing depends on the condition of the existing sealant and environmental factors, but generally, resealing every few years is recommended.
What types of sealants are used for foundations? Common sealants include epoxy coatings, elastomeric membranes, and waterproof paints designed specifically for concrete surfaces.
